Address Details

0xE513eEC996e863720Cc681c4a7E482d708C87765

Balance
780.553583999912388 ETN ( )
Tokens
Fetching tokens...
Transactions
383 Transactions
Transfers
0 Transfers
Gas Used
8,043,000
Last Balance Update
5255373
Connection Lost, click to load newer transactions

Transactions

There are no transactions for this address.